Close: positive earnings U.S. stocks closed higher with the data

U.S. stocks ended higher on Monday. Investors in the volatile situation in North Africa, to wait and see attitude. Exxon Mobil earnings and better than expected economic data boosted market sentiment.

EST at 16:00 on January 31st, the Dow Jones industrial average rose 68.23 points to close at 11,891.93 points, or 0.58%; the Nasdaq composite index rose 13.19 points to close at 2,700.08 points, or 0.49%; the S & P 500 index rose 9.78 points to close at 1,286.12 points, or 0.77%.

The Dow on Monday for the first time in four years to achieve the 1 month closing high on line, and harvest the best performance since 1997 in January. So far this month, the Dow has risen more than 2%. S & P 500 Index so far this year has risen by 2%, the Nasdaq rose 1%.

Chip giant Intel (INTC) closed flat, due to design flaws found in chipsets, Intel shares have been suspended from trading morning, then resumed. Intel also raised its revenue outlook as a whole.

Today morning the news of Intel's stock was suspended from trading stocks to go so soft. The chip giant reported that chipset design defects, thereby reducing the expected revenue to $ 300,000,000.

Oil giant Exxon Mobil (XOM) rose 2.1%. The company said its fourth-quarter profit rising oil prices increased by 53%, exceeding market expectations. Exxon Mobil earnings by the promotion of general rise in the energy sector.

Federal Reserve (Fed) Chairman Ben Bernanke (Ben Bernanke) will be held Feb. 9 at the House Budget Committee (House Budget Committee) to testify, since the Republican-controlled House of Representatives for his first appearance since the House Budget Committee.

 Bernanke will be the week of Feb. 12 to attend the hearing, the Congressional Budget Office Director Al Elmendorf (Doug Elmendorf) will be 10 witnesses.

 House Budget Committee Chairman Paul. Ryan (Paul Ryan) will play a key role in the hearing, to fight on behalf of Republican control of federal government spending to achieve the purpose. The Budget Committee hearing on the subject will certainly be issues around the fiscal imbalance.

 Earlier, Bernanke in early January before the Senate Banking Committee (Senate Budget Committee) to testify.

Fed: M1 increased by 0.52% 1.63% M2

The Fed on Jan. 27 to the latest week, the money supply report showed a seasonally adjusted basis, as of January 17 the week of the M1 money supply increased 30.3 billion, to $ 1,853,000,000,000; M2 money supply increased 466 Billion, to $ 8,862,000,000,000.
3.Continued maintenance of stability at the end of the Fed or small-scale "Exit"
Federal Reserve monetary policy meeting in 26 said in a statement after the regular decision-making, peacekeeping in the country will continue to benchmark interest rate from 0 to a record low of 0.25% unchanged, in order to further stimulate the U.S. economic recovery. In addition, plans will continue to promote the 600 billion U.S. dollars by bond purchase plan.
Analysts pointed out that can be seen from the statement, the job market downturn in the short term change in U.S. policy will not loose, but the U.S. economic recovery has been enhanced, quantitative easing policy has stimulated efforts to reduce even the possibility of early termination.
The Fed said in a statement, to keep the benchmark interest rate to 0.25% at 0 range unchanged. Since since March 2009, the Fed has been reiterated in a longer time to maintain interest rates at low levels.
Statement that the U.S. economy is recovering, but not enough to significantly improve the recovery rate of employment. In this regard, CITIC Securities International, said Hu Yifan macroeconomic researchers, such macro-economic environment prompted the Fed to maintain its expansionary monetary policy stance. The federal funds rate may be maintained in the longer period of time at very low levels, there will be no change this year.
As the Fed statement said, the high unemployment rate is still the reason for the Fed to maintain an accommodative policy. Although the U.S. unemployment rate in December compared with a significant reduction to 9.4%, but still a high level, and when the weekly number of initial claims for unemployment benefits still volatile. This means that the U.S. economy still needs a more robust recovery in order to bring the unemployment rate to achieve sustained, significant recovery.

Differentiation trend of the three major U.S. stock index edged down 0.03% Dow

The three major U.S. stock index on January 25 is mixed, the Dow edged down 0.03%, Nasdaq, S & P was up. At the close, the Dow Jones industrial average closed at 11,977.19 points, down 3.33 points, or 0.03%; the Nasdaq composite index closed at 2719.25 points, up 1.70 points, or 0.06%; the S & P 500 index closed at 1291.18 points , up 0.34 points, or 0.03%.
From the disk point of view, technology stocks is mixed, Ericsson closed up 3.92%, Cisco, Intel, Google and other closing rose over 1%. Nokia, Texas Instruments closed down, Yahoo was down 0.44%, the company reported fourth quarter reported a net profit of 312 million, an increase of 104%. Most financial stocks weakened, Goldman Sachs, American Express, Bank of America fell more than 2%, CIGNA, Allstate and other close up.
Message level, the U.S. Conference Board on Tuesday announced that January's consumer confidence index was 60.6 points higher than the market expected. In addition, Standard & Poor's report, in November 2010 across the board decline in U.S. housing prices in major cities, the overall decline than expected.
